Her Deliverance

Her Deliverance (2024)

A woman ventures to a church amid a storm to see if she can't get some help with some... eerie visions and feelings. Haunted by them, she seeks salvation in any way she can. Is this really a curse? And if so... can she overcome it, in the end?

  • Release Date: October 25, 2024
  • Developer: Egg